Motor vehicle taxation brings in €440.4B for governments in major European markets

Green Car Congress

The three countries that do not apply CO2-based taxation are Estonia, Lithuania and Poland. Most countries grant only tax reductions or exemptions. According to the new Guide , 24 countries levy car taxes partially or totally based on the CO 2 emissions and/or fuel consumption of a vehicle.

Tesla Model 3 SR Plus sold out in UK for Q2 despite zero EV purchase incentives

Teslarati

Research by Select Car Leasing shows that the UK has one of the lowest EV purchase grants in Europe, ranking number 14 in the study. Estonia has the highest EV purchase grant in Europe with £15,500 ($21,622.36). With a price tag of £40,990 ($57,180.68), the Model 3 SR+ is not eligible for the UK’s plug-in grant.

Jordan signs $2B oil shale investment agreement with Saudi company

Green Car Congress

The government of Jordan and the Saudi Arabian Corporation for Oil Shale (SACOS) recently signed a $2-billion agreement under which the government grants the Saudi company the right to extract and to develop the oil shale resources in the Attarat Um-AL-Ghudran region covering an area of 11 square kilometers.
